25th November Reception Lighting Engineers

Today it was Reception children who became lighting engineers, investigating light, shadow and colours. why not try our NUSTEM at home Light Reflecting Mobiles activity? This uses anything shiny you can find!

22nd November Nursery Lighting Engineers

Today Nursery have been lighting engineers and investigated light and shadows using torches and light boxes. Why not try our Shadow Tubes STEM at home activity, which uses only a torch, toilet roll tube and cling film.

19th November KS1 Naval Architects

Year 1 and 2 have been designing, building and testing boats this morning. To try this at home, go to our Naval Architects STEM at home activity, which uses only a piece of tin foil and some coins.
